CloudFileClient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t eine clientseitige logische Darstellung des Microsoft Azure-Dateidiensts bereit. Dieser Client wird verwendet, um Anforderungen für den File-Dienst zu konfigurieren und auszuführen.
public class CloudFileClient
type CloudFileClient = class
Public Class CloudFileClient
- Vererbung
-
CloudFileClient
Hinweise
Der Dienstclient kapselt den Basis-URI für den File-Dienst. Wenn der Dienstclient für den authentifizierten Zugriff verwendet wird, kapselt er auch die Anmeldeinformationen für den Zugriff auf das Speicherkonto.
Konstruktoren
CloudFileClient(StorageUri, StorageCredentials, DelegatingHandler) |
Initialisiert eine neue Instanz der CloudFileClient-Klasse mithilfe des angegebenen File-Dienstendpunkts und der Kontoanmeldeinformationen. |
CloudFileClient(Uri, StorageCredentials, DelegatingHandler) |
Initialisiert eine neue Instanz der CloudFileClient-Klasse mithilfe des angegebenen File-Dienstendpunkts und der Kontoanmeldeinformationen. |
Eigenschaften
AuthenticationScheme |
Ruft das Authentifizierungsschema ab, das zum Signieren von HTTP-Anforderungen verwendet werden soll, oder legt es fest. |
BaseUri |
Ruft den Basis-URI für den File-Dienstclient ab. |
BufferManager |
Ruft einen Puffer-Manager, der die IBufferManager-Schnittstelle implementiert, ab oder legt ihn fest, wobei ein mit Vorgängen für den File-Dienstclient zu verwendender Pufferpool angegeben wird. |
Credentials |
Ruft die Kontoanmeldeinformationen ab, die zum Erstellen des File-Dienstclients verwendet wurden. |
DefaultRequestOptions |
Ruft die standardmäßigen Anforderungsoptionen für über den File-Dienstclient vorgenommene Anforderungen ab oder legt sie fest. |
StorageUri |
Ruft die Liste der URIs für alle Speicherorte ab. |
Methoden
BeginGetServiceProperties(AsyncCallback, Object) |
Startet einen asynchronen Vorgang zum Abrufen von Diensteigenschaften für den Dateidienst. |
BeginGetServiceProperties(FileRequestOptions, OperationContext, AsyncCallback, Object) |
Startet einen asynchronen Vorgang zum Abrufen von Diensteigenschaften für den Dateidienst. |
BeginListSharesSegmented(FileContinuationToken, AsyncCallback, Object) |
Startet eine asynchrone Anforderung,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ält. |
BeginListSharesSegmented(String, FileContinuationToken, AsyncCallback, Object) |
Startet eine asynchrone Anforderung,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ält. |
BeginListSharesSegmented(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ext, AsyncCallback, Object) |
Startet eine asynchrone Anforderung, um ein Ergebnissegment zurückzugeben, das eine Auflistung von Freigaben enthält, deren Namen mit dem angegebenen Präfix beginnen. |
BeginSetServiceProperties(FileServiceProperties, AsyncCallback, Object) |
Startet einen asynchronen Vorgang, um Diensteigenschaften für den Dateidienst festzulegen. |
BeginSetServiceProperties(FileServiceProperties, FileRequestOptions, OperationContext, AsyncCallback, Object) |
Startet einen asynchronen Vorgang, um Diensteigenschaften für den Dateidienst festzulegen. |
EndGetServiceProperties(IAsyncResult) |
Beendet einen asynchronen Vorgang zum Abrufen von Diensteigenschaften für den Dateidienst. |
EndListSharesSegmented(IAsyncResult) |
Beendet einen asynchronen Vorgang, um ein Ergebnissegment zurückzugeben, das eine Auflistung von Freigaben enthält. |
EndSetServiceProperties(IAsyncResult) |
Beendet einen asynchronen Vorgang, um Diensteigenschaften für den Blobdienst festzulegen. |
GetServiceProperties(FileRequestOptions, OperationContext) |
Ruft Diensteigenschaften für den Dateidienst ab. |
GetServicePropertiesAsync() |
Initiiert einen asynchronen Vorgang zum Abrufen von Diensteigenschaften für den Dateidienst. |
GetServicePropertiesAsync(CancellationToken) |
Initiiert einen asynchronen Vorgang zum Abrufen von Diensteigenschaften für den Dateidienst. |
GetServicePropertiesAsync(FileRequestOptions, OperationContext) |
Initiiert einen asynchronen Vorgang zum Abrufen von Diensteigenschaften für den Dateidienst. |
GetServicePropertiesAsync(FileRequestOptions, OperationContext, CancellationToken) |
Initiiert einen asynchronen Vorgang zum Abrufen von Diensteigenschaften für den Dateidienst. |
GetShareReference(String) |
Gibt einen Verweis auf ein CloudFileShare-Objekt mit dem angegebenen Namen zurück. |
GetShareReference(String, Nullable<DateTimeOffset>) |
Gibt einen Verweis auf ein CloudFileShare Objekt mit dem angegebenen Namen und Momentaufnahme Zeit zurück. |
ListShares(String, ShareListingDetails, FileRequestOptions, OperationContext) |
Gibt eine aufzählbare Auflistung von Freigaben zurück, die verzögert abgerufen werden, deren Namen mit dem angegebenen Präfix beginnen. |
ListSharesSegmented(FileContinuationToken) |
Gibt ein Ergebnissegment mit einer Auflistung von Freigaben zurück. |
ListSharesSegmented(String, FileContinuationToken) |
Gibt ein Ergebnissegment mit einer Auflistung von Freigaben zurück. |
ListSharesSegmented(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ext) |
Gibt ein Ergebnissegment zurück, das eine Auflistung der Freigaben enthält, deren Namen mit dem angegebenen Präfix beginnen. |
ListSharesSegmentedAsync(FileContinuationToken) |
Gibt einen Task zurück, der eine asynchrone Anforderung ausführt,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ält. |
ListSharesSegmentedAsync(FileContinuationToken, CancellationToken) |
Gibt einen Task zurück, der eine asynchrone Anforderung ausführt,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ält. |
ListSharesSegmentedAsync(String, FileContinuationToken) |
Gibt einen Task zurück, der eine asynchrone Anforderung ausführt,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ält, deren Namen mit dem angegebenen Präfix beginnen. |
ListSharesSegmentedAsync(String, FileContinuationToken, CancellationToken) |
Gibt einen Task zurück, der eine asynchrone Anforderung ausführt,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ält, deren Namen mit dem angegebenen Präfix beginnen. |
ListSharesSegmentedAsync(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ext) |
Gibt einen Task zurück, der eine asynchrone Anforderung ausführt,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ält, deren Namen mit dem angegebenen Präfix beginnen. |
ListSharesSegmentedAsync(String, ShareListingDetails, Nullable<Int32>, FileContinuationToken, FileRequestOptions, OperationContext, CancellationToken) |
Gibt einen Task zurück, der eine asynchrone Anforderung ausführt, um ein Ergebnissegment zurückzugeben, das eine Sammlung von Freigaben enthält, deren Namen mit dem angegebenen Präfix beginnen. |
SetServiceProperties(FileServiceProperties, FileRequestOptions, OperationContext) |
Legt Diensteigenschaften für den Dateidienst fest. |
SetServicePropertiesAsync(FileServiceProperties) |
Initiiert einen asynchronen Vorgang, der Diensteigenschaften für den Blobdienst festlegt. |
SetServicePropertiesAsync(FileServiceProperties, CancellationToken) |
Initiiert einen asynchronen Vorgang, der Diensteigenschaften für den Blobdienst festlegt. |
SetServicePropertiesAsync(FileServiceProperties, FileRequestOptions, OperationContext) |
Initiiert einen asynchronen Vorgang, der Diensteigenschaften für den Dateidienst festlegt. |
SetServicePropertiesAsync(FileServiceProperties, FileRequestOptions, OperationContext, CancellationToken) |
Initiiert einen asynchronen Vorgang, der Diensteigenschaften für den Dateidienst festlegt. |
Gilt für:
Azure SDK for .NET